About Madison Country Club
Madison Country Club is a historic private club founded in 1909 in Madison, Connecticut, featuring an 18-hole championship course originally designed by Willie Park Jr., the two-time Open champion. The layout winds through marshes and hardwood forests, and a hilltop clubhouse built in 1917 offers panoramic views of Long Island Sound, with the course further shaped by Robert Trent Jones Sr. in 1960 and fully renovated by Roger Rulewich in 1998.
